| AN ACT |
| |
1 | Amending Title 42 (Judiciary and Judicial Procedure) of the |
2 | Pennsylvania Consolidated Statutes, further providing for |
3 | death action. |
4 | The General Assembly of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ania |
5 | hereby enacts as follows: |
6 | Section 1. Section 8301 of Title 42 of the Pennsylvania |
7 | Consolidated Statutes is amended to read: |
8 | § 8301. Death action. |
9 | (a) General rule.--An action may be brought, under |
10 | procedures prescribed by general rules, to recover damages for |
11 | the death of an individual caused by the wrongful act or neglect |
12 | or unlawful violence or negligence of another if no recovery for |
13 | the same damages claimed in the wrongful death action was |
14 | obtained by the injured individual during his lifetime and any |
15 | prior actions for the same injuries are consolidated with the |
|
1 | wrongful death claim so as to avoid a duplicate recovery. |
2 | (b) Beneficiaries.--Except as provided in subsection (d), |
3 | the right of action created by this section shall exist only for |
4 | the benefit of the spouse, children or parents of the deceased, |
5 | whether or not citizens or residents of this Commonwealth or |
6 | elsewhere. The damages recovered shall be distributed to the |
7 | beneficiaries in the proportion they would take the personal |
8 | estate of the decedent in the case of intestacy and without |
9 | liability to creditors of the deceased person under the statutes |
10 | of this Commonwealth. |
11 | (c) Special damages.--In an action brought under subsection |
12 | (a), the plaintiff shall be entitled to recover, in addition to |
13 | other damages, damages for the mental anguish and sorrow |
14 | incurred by the surviving spouse, dependent children, parents or |
15 | next of kin of the decedent and damages for reasonable hospital, |
16 | nursing, medical, funeral expenses and expenses of |
17 | administration necessitated by reason of injuries causing death. |
18 | (d) Action by personal representative.--If no person is |
19 | eligible to recover damages under subsection (b), the personal |
20 | representative of the deceased may bring an action to recover |
21 | damages for reasonable hospital, nursing, medical, funeral |
22 | expenses and expenses of administration necessitated by reason |
23 | of injuries causing death. |
24 | Section 2. This act shall take effect in 60 days. |
